I share your wish. In the meantime, the following from ZAMM is my 
guess at how Pirsig's views the current state of affairs:

"My personal feeling is that this is how any further improvement of the 
world will be done: by individuals making Quality decisions and that´s all. 
God, I don´t want to have any more enthusiasm for big programs full of 
social planning for big masses of people that leave individual Quality 
out. These can be left alone for a while. There´s a place for them but 
they´ve got to be built on a foundation of Quality within the individuals 
involved. We´ve had that individual Quality in the past, exploited it as a 
natural resource without knowing it, and now it´s just about depleted. 
Everyone´s just about out of gumption. And I think it´s about time to 
return to the rebuilding of this American resource...individual worth. 
There are political reactionaries who´ve been saying something close to 
this for years. I´m not one of them, but to the extent they´re talking about 
real individual worth and not just an excuse for giving more money to 
the rich, they´re right. We do need a return to individual integrity, self-
reliance and old-fashioned gumption. We really do."
